Understanding Testosterone

Testosterone is a hormone that plays a crucial role in the development and maintenance of male characteristics. It is primarily produced in the testes, but small amounts are also produced in the adrenal glands. Testosterone is responsible for muscle and bone growth, sperm production, and the development of secondary sexual characteristics such as facial hair and deepening of the voice. The Anabolic Effects of Testosterone

One of the most well-known effects of testosterone is its anabolic properties, which means it promotes muscle growth. Testosterone increases muscle protein synthesis, which is the process by which cells build proteins to repair and build new muscle tissue. It also enhances nitrogen retention, leading to increased muscle mass and strength. Additionally, testosterone stimulates the production of growth hormone, another hormone that plays a vital role in muscle growth and repair.

The Impact of Testosterone on Muscle Fiber Type

Testosterone not only increases muscle size and strength but also influences muscle fiber type. There are two main types of muscle fibers: slow-twitch (Type I) and fast-twitch (Type II) fibers. Slow-twitch fibers are responsible for endurance activities, while fast-twitch fibers are associated with strength and power. Testosterone has been found to increase the proportion of fast-twitch fibers in muscles, enabling individuals to generate more force and power during physical activities.

The Importance of Testosterone in Recovery and Repair

In addition to promoting muscle growth, testosterone also plays a crucial role in muscle recovery and repair. During intense exercise, muscle fibers experience micro-tears, which need to be repaired for the muscle to grow stronger. Testosterone helps facilitate the repair process by stimulating the production of satellite cells, which are responsible for muscle regeneration. It also reduces inflammation and inhibits the breakdown of protein, further supporting muscle recovery.

The Relationship Between Testosterone and Exercise

Regular exercise has been found to increase testosterone levels in both men and women. Resistance training, in particular, has been shown to have a significant impact on testosterone production. High-intensity and heavy resistance exercises that target large muscle groups can lead to a temporary surge in testosterone levels. Moreover, engaging in consistent and challenging exercise routines over time can help maintain optimal testosterone levels, ensuring continued muscle growth and development.

Maximizing Testosterone Levels Naturally

While testosterone replacement therapy is an option for individuals with clinically low testosterone levels, there are natural ways to maximize testosterone production. Adequate sleep, a healthy diet rich in protein and essential nutrients, and weight management can all contribute to optimal testosterone levels. Additionally, reducing stress and avoiding excessive alcohol consumption can help maintain hormonal balance.
